Mass Torts

In certain instances, dangerous drugs may cause injury to only a limited number of people, but the effects they cause are similar. These cases are covered under the law of product liability and permit injured victims to file a lawsuit against drug companies under strict negligence theories.

Dangerous drug cases can include one or more defendants, based on the alleged actions that led to their injuries. For example, if a drug was manufactured as well as prescribed by a physician, both parties could be named in the lawsuit. In this scenario, the injured party must prove that the manufacturer and doctor were negligent when it came to making or manufacturing the medication that ultimately resulted in the injury.

Multi-district litigation is a method to consolidate many of these cases of injury resulting from drugs. All cases that make the similar allegations against the same defendant are presented to the same judge in order to settle the lawsuits quickly and efficiently. The most experienced dangerous drug lawyers will ensure that each case is treated as a separate legal action, and that the plaintiff is more in control of the outcome of their case.

Like all personal injury lawsuits, defective or dangerous drug suits require the use of medical specialists and specialists to prove that a defendant's actions were the direct reason for the damages suffered by a patient. This is an important distinction from other types of lawsuits, such as motor vehicle collisions, where it's much simpler to prove that the driver ran a red light and hit your car.

It is also important to realize that it is not necessarily immediately obvious when a person has been injured by a medication they took, as the injuries might not be evident right away. Many of the most dangerous OTC and prescription medications are not recalls until thousands or hundreds of people have been affected.

Prescription Drugs

Even though many prescription drugs are approved and regulated by the FDA but they could cause serious or even fatal side effects. In certain cases the pharmaceutical companies that manufacture and sell these medications could be held accountable for any harm they cause. This type of legal action can be referred to as a dangerous drug suit. These cases are often brought in class actions against the company and are founded on evidence of injuries suffered by plaintiffs. In a case involving a risky drug, settlement amounts are according to a variety of factors, including the type of injury, the severity, the age of the plaintiff, the medical expenses related to the injury and the projected loss of income.

Dangerous drug claims are a kind of personal injury claim and can be filed with claims for wrongful death. A lawsuit may seek to recover damages that are specific to the injured party including suffering and pain, emotional distress, medical expenses and loss of future earnings. In cases of death, compensation could include funeral and burial costs.

The most common defendants in lawsuits involving dangerous drugs are pharmaceutical companies. However, other parties can be held responsible too. For example, a sales representative might fail to notify doctors of the dangers and hazards that aren't listed on a drug's label for certain patient groups.

Furthermore, manufacturing flaws can also lead to dangerous drug lawsuits. In these instances something goes wrong during the manufacturing process. For instance contamination. In these instances the manufacturer as well as the company that developed the medication could be listed as defendants.
